Investors are on the edges of their seats, hoping that Cadence Design Systems (Nasdaq: CDNS) will top analyst expectations for the fourth consecutive quarter. The company will unveil its latest earnings on Thursday, July 28. Cadence Design Systems develops electronic design automation software and hardware. It also licenses software, sells hardware technology, and provides engineering and education services throughout the world.

What analysts say:

  • Buy, sell, or hold?: The majority of analysts back Cadence Design Systems as a buy. But with 57.1% of analysts rating it a buy, Cadence Design Systems is still below the mean analyst rating of its nearest 10 competitors, which average 61.5% buys. Analysts don't like Cadence Design Systems as much as competitor Teradyne overall. Eight out of 13 analysts rate Teradyne a buy compared to four of seven for Cadence Design Systems. While analysts still rate the stock a moderate buy, they are a little more optimistic about it compared to three months ago.
  • Revenue Forecasts: On average, analysts predict $275.9 million in revenue this quarter. That would represent a rise of 21.5% from the year-ago quarter.
  • Wall Street Earnings Expectations: The average analyst estimate is earnings of $0.08 per share.
